The existing studies focus mainly on the zero forcing of self-interference without the suppression for the RF transmitter noise in the full-duplex base station with multiple transmit and receive antennas.Considering the suppression for the RF transmitter noise
this paper proposes a joint transmit and receive beamforming algorithm.First
we derive the analytical expression of the receiver beamforming vector based on the maximum signal-to-interference-noise ratio(SINR) criterion.The algorithm for designing the transmit beamforming vector is then given by minimizing self-interference.The simulation results show that when the signal-to-noise ratio(SNR) are 30dB and 60dB respectively
the values of the self-interference cancellation are 65.5dB and 89.8dB for the base station with three transmit and three receive antennas.Meanwhile
the corresponding improvement are 25.5dB and 19.8dB respectively compared to the SVD zero forcing scheme.
